Study on Level of Rare Earth ELements Content of Children’s Blood and Affecting Factors

  • Objective To study the level of rare earth elements(REEs)content in children's blood and its affecting factors.Methods Blood REEs were determined by inductively coupled plasma source mass pectrometry(ICP-MS)in 112 children aged 7-10 years randomly sampled in the area containing rare earth(RE)ore and the control area in Xunwu county,Jiangxi and multiple regression analysis of blood REEs level was conducted on them.Results All 15 kinds of REEs were detected in each sample.The blood REEs content in RE ore area was 2.18±1.08ng/g and 1.73 times of the control area(1.26±0.35ng/g).The difference was significantly great(P<0.01).Seen from fifteen kinds of REEs,eleven kinds of REEs increased in children's blood in RE ore area,total light REEs content was 0.85 times higher and total heavy REEs content was 0.51 times higher than that in the control area.The difference was significant(P<0.01).Multiple regression analysis showed that distance from home to the RE area was the principal factor that affected the blood REEs content.Conclusion The blood REEs content would be higher if living a long time in the environment with high concentration of REEs.The blood REEs content can reflect the level of REEs content in human body to a certain extent.
